Ticket: TRANSCODE — expired credentials on Fernpool farm

The nightly batch on the Fernpool transcoding farm began failing at 02:10 because the worker credential for the internal Meshcut API expired. All HD renditions are queued, not lost. Please update the worker config on each node and restart the scheduler. The replacement key issued by platform is below.

service key, fawip-bajef: kto11_Qt5wZK9vdNC

Ticket: Config drift on Marrowbank pool settings.

Prod nodes 3 and 5 show pool sizes diverging from the deploy manifest — likely a manual hotfix that never landed in source. Connection exhaustion alerts firing hourly. Need the canonical values reapplied before Thursday's release. Expected configuration is as follows.

deployment values, yahag-tawef:
ZORWYN_HOST=zorwyn.tolvaqlabs.internal
ZORWYN_PORT=9300

Memo — Inventory Write-down, Attn: Sales Leads

Finance has approved a write-down on remaining Ardelle fixture stock at the Merrowgate warehouse. Carrying value drops roughly 35%, effective this period. Sales leads should stop quoting list price on affected SKUs and use the clearance sheet instead. Questions go to Priya in controlling. The confidential note on forward plans appears below.

management briefing: Headcount on the Quenael team goes from 9 to 80 by the end of July. Gross margin on Quenael came in at 15 percent against a plan of 20 percent.

TURN-208: Gatevale turnstile counters at the Merrow Field pilot double-count when a rotation reverses mid-cycle. Attendance totals drift roughly 2% high per event. The debounce window fix is implemented, reviewed by Ilsa, and soak-tested across two simulated match days without drift. Ready for your cut; the candidate build is identified below.

trace token, tagag-tafog: htk6_5ed18c